20W Photovoltaic module – 420J
(1) STC
(2) NOCT
Electrical characteristics 1000W/m2 800W/m2
Maximum power (Pmax) 20W 14.4W
Voltage at Pmax (Vmpp) 16.8V 15.0V
Current at Pmax (Impp) 1.19A 0.95A
Short circuit current (Isc) 1.29A 1.04A
Open circuit voltage (Voc) 21.0V 19.1V
Module efficiency 9.4%
Tolerance Pmax ± 10%
Nominal voltage 12V
2
Efficiency reduction at 200W/m <5% reduction (efficiency 8.9%)
Limiting reverse current 1.29A
Temperature coefficient of Isc 0.105%/ °C
Temperature coefficient of Voc 0.360%/ °C
Temperature coefficient of Pmax -0.45%/ °C
(3)
NOCT 47 ±2 °C
Maximum series fuse rating 3A
Application class Class C (according to IEC 61730-2007)
Maximum system voltage 20V
1: Values at Standard Test Conditions (STC): 1000W/m2 irradiance, AM1.5 solar spectrum and 25°C module temperature
2: Values at 800W/m2 irradiance, Nominal Operation Cell Temperature (NOCT) and AM1.5 solar spectrum
3: Nominal Operation Cell Temperature: Module operation temperature at 800W/m2 irradiance, 20°C air temperature, 1m/s wind speed
All solar modules are individually tested prior to shipment; an allowance is made within our factory measurement to account for
the typical power degradation (LILD effect) which occurs during the first few days of deployment.
SES MAPPS Solar Module Mechanical characteristics
Solar cells 36 monocrystalline silicon cut cells in series
Front cover High transmission 3.2mm (1/8“) glass
Encapsulant EVA
Back cover White polyester
Frame Silver anodized aluminum
Junction IP65 with 4 terminal screw connection block; accepts PG 13.5, M20 13mm
box (½“) conduit, or cable fittings accepting 6-12mm diameter cable.
Terminals accept 2.5-10mm2 (8-14 AWG) wire
Dimensions 839 x 537 x 50mm / 33.0 x 21.1 x 2in
Weight 6kg / 13.2lbs
All dimensional tolerances within ±1% unless otherwise stated.
